We have put together a set for you, where you will find the necessary amount of material to make one heating pad:
- wheat (if you like it, you can add dried lavender to the wheat, the pillow will smell beautifully when heated)
- cotton canvas on the inner pocket
- patterned cotton fabric for a washable cover
We take out the individual parts from the package. We'll start with the inner coating that the wheat will go into. Fold the white canvas in half, sew one short and one long side (embroider an L shape). Turn it inside out and mark 15 cm from each edge with soapy chalk .
We divide the wheat into three equal parts, we found it useful to use three glasses for better handling. Pour the contents of the first glass into the sewn pocket and sew the first part. We repeat the same with the second and third glasses. We close the pocket with the last seam and thus have the inner part of the heating bag ready.
Now we just have to finish the cover and we're done. We use patterned cotton for the cover, we have prepared 4 color variants for you in the sets, from which everyone can choose. We clean the long edges with a double fold, then we fold the edges to the center and mark approx. 15 cm from each edge with soap chalk and sew to create a pocket in the middle for inserting a bag of wheat.
As the last step, we sew the sides together, turn it inside out, insert the inner pocket with the wheat, and the heating pad is ready.
You can find detailed video instructions on our Facebook and Instagram .
The easiest way to heat the pillow is in the microwave at a power of 600W and heat it for one minute. Some people prefer warmer, others colder. Over time, you will figure out which warm-up suits you best. The outer coating can be easily removed, so the maintenance of the bag is really simple. We recommend washing the outer cover at a maximum of 40 degrees.

This heating pad contains a pocket for essential oils or dried herbs that are released when heated. The aromatherapy heating pad is ideal for those who enjoy soothing and relaxing scents.
Magnetic therapy is an alternative treatment method that uses magnetic fields to treat pain and inflammation. By adding small magnets to your heating pad, you can create a combination therapy tool.
This version of the heating pad contains small massage balls that help release tension in the muscles on which the pad is used.
A cooling pad can be useful for reducing swelling or pain caused by inflammation. This variant of the heating pad can be used as a regular heating pad or a cooling pad if you let it cool in the freezer.
With these options, you can create a heating pad that will suit your individual needs. You can also combine different elements from multiple variants into one pad, for example by adding an aromatherapy pouch to a cooling pad. When creating a heating pad, you can use leftover fabrics and use them to create original accessories and details that will increase the usability and comfort of using the pad. Here are some ideas on how to achieve this.
Additional pockets for herbs or essential oils - you can add small pockets to the pillow to store herbs or essential oils. This will ensure that when the pillow is heated, a pleasant aroma will be released, which will increase the relaxing effect.
Sewn-in elastic band for easier holding of the pillow - sew an elastic band from strong elastic material that you attach to the back of the pillow. This ensures that you can attach the pillow to your body and enjoy its warmth without having to constantly hold it.
Personal appearance of the pillow - create an original cover for your pillow that will match the personality of the recipient. You can use different fabrics, patterns, prints or applications. Such a pillow will be not only useful, but also stylish and unique.
Patches or applications - if you have fabric scraps with a print or pattern, you can use them to create patches or applications, which you then attach to the surface of the pillow. Such a detail will give the pillow an original look.
Loop for hanging - you can use leftover fabric to create a loop for hanging the pillow. Sew a ribbon on one of the corners of the cushion, which will facilitate its storage and at the same time serve as a decorative element.

Heating pads can also be made from different materials, which can affect their properties, texture and overall appearance. In this article, we will look at several variants of heating pads with different fabric materials that can be suitable for different situations, occasions and benefits.
Materials such as cotton , fleece or flannel are ideal for light and soft heating pads. These pads are suitable for children, the elderly or people with sensitive skin who prefer a softer touch. Soft and light materials also contribute to the feeling of comfort and relaxation.
Materials such as canvas or heavy cotton are suitable for more complex variants of the heating pad, which require greater resistance and strength. These pads are suitable for people who are looking for more support or need to heat larger parts of the body. Stronger materials also improve the long-term durability of the heating pad.
If you are looking for a heating pad that is suitable for special occasions or as a luxury gift, you can consider using materials such as silk , velvet or brocade. These materials add aesthetic value and a sense of luxury. Luxury heating pads can be suitable for relaxation procedures in the wellness area, as a gift for a loved one or as part of interior decoration.
